gratiné adjective[ after noun ] food & drink specialized(alsogratinée)uk /ˈɡræt.ɪˌneɪ/ us /ˌɡræt̬.ɪˈneɪ/ cooked au gratin(= with a covering of cheese or very small pieces of bread mixed with butter): They serve excellent French food and wine for lunch and dinner, with classics such as onion soup gratinée. The version of Coquilles St-Jacques from Brittany is served gratiné. Heat under the grill for about 7 minutes if you want it to be completely gratiné. The crab gratinée appetizer was worth the whole trip. Chicken Tetrazzini consists of strips of cooked chicken and spaghetti in a cream sauce, gratiné.
